【docker】docker安装nginx

1、docker hub

https://hub.docker.com/_/nginx

 

2、安装

默认配置安装

docker run --name nginx -d nginx

指定端口安装

docker run --name nginx -d -p 8080:80 nginx

文件映射主机安装

#mkdir -p $HOME/Tools/{html,conf,logs}
#touch nginx.conf


docker run -d \
 --name nginx \
 -m 200m \
 -p 8080:80 \
 -v $HOME/Tools/nginx/nginx.conf:/etc/nginx/nginx.conf \
 -v $HOME/Tools/nginx/logs:/var/log/nginx \
 -v $HOME/Tools/nginx/html:/usr/share/nginx/html \
 -v $HOME/Tools/nginx/conf:/etc/nginx/conf.d \
 -e TZ=Asia/Shanghai \
 --privileged=true \
 nginx

 

3、访问测试

Then you can hit http://localhost:8080 or http://host-ip:8080 in your browser

 

 

 

参考链接:

https://blog.csdn.net/weixin_46244732/article/details/114315708

posted @ 2022-08-23 10:52  代码诠释的世界  阅读(47)  评论(0编辑  收藏  举报